Use this option to specify all automounted file systems the <strong>Tivoli</strong> <strong>Storage</strong> <strong>Manager</strong>client tries to mount at the following points in time:v When <strong>Tivoli</strong> <strong>Storage</strong> <strong>Manager</strong> client startsv When the backup is startedv When the <strong>Tivoli</strong> <strong>Storage</strong> <strong>Manager</strong> client has reached an automounted file systemduring backupIt is unnecessary to explicitly specify an automounted file system in the automountstatement if you use the keywords all-auto-nfs or all-auto-lofs in the domainstatement <strong>and</strong> the file system is already mounted. However, you should add thisfile system in the automount statement to ensure the file system has been mountedat all the points in time mentioned above. The automounted file systems areremounted if they have gone offline in the meantime during a backup.Supported ClientsThis option is valid <strong>for</strong> all <strong>UNIX</strong> plat<strong>for</strong>ms except Mac OS X. The <strong>Tivoli</strong> <strong>Storage</strong><strong>Manager</strong> client API does not support this option.Options FilePlace this option in the client user options file (dsm.opt).Syntax►►▼AUTOMount filespacename ►◄<strong>Backup</strong>setnameParametersfilespacenameSpecifies one or more automounted file systems that are mounted <strong>and</strong> addedinto the domain.ExamplesOptions file:automount fs1 fs2Comm<strong>and</strong> line:Does not apply.Related in<strong>for</strong>mationSee “Domain” on page 296 <strong>for</strong> more in<strong>for</strong>mation about working with automountedfile systems <strong>and</strong> the domain option.The backupsetname option specifies the name of a backup set from the <strong>Tivoli</strong><strong>Storage</strong> <strong>Manager</strong> server.
